About Tolaz LA 405mg/vial Convenience Kit
Tolaz LA 405mg/vial Convenience Kit is primarily used to treat schizophrenia and manic or mixed episodes of bipolar I disorder. Schizophrenia is a mental condition that causes hallucinations, false beliefs, and confusion. Bipolar I disorder causes extreme mood swings with changes in thinking and behaviour.
Tolaz LA 405mg/vial Convenience Kit contains olanzapine, which helps balance brain chemicals linked to mood and behaviour. It improves thinking and mental clarity and reduces hallucinations and agitation. It also helps control manic episodes. This supports better emotional balance and daily functioning.
Tolaz LA 405mg/vial Convenience Kit will be administered by a health care professional. Common side effects include drowsiness, dizziness, headache, dry mouth, nausea, vomiting, diarrhoea, constipation, stomach pain, back pain, runny/stuffy nose, cough, increased appetite, weight gain, and redness/pain/swelling at the injection site. If you notice any side effects that are not manageable, please consult your doctor.
Tolaz LA 405mg/vial Convenience Kit is not recommended for treatment in patients with Dementia-Related Psychosis. If you are pregnant, planning to conceive, or breastfeeding, inform your doctor before receiving Tolaz LA 405mg/vial Convenience Kit. Tolaz LA 405mg/vial Convenience Kit is not recommended for children and adolescents under 18. However, please seek medical advice.

Alcohol
Unsafe
Avoid alcohol consumption while taking Tolaz LA 405mg/vial Convenience Kit as it may cause increased dizziness and drowsiness.
Pregnancy
Caution
Tolaz LA 405mg/vial Convenience Kit is a pregnancy category C drug. Using antipsychotic drugs during the third trimester of pregnancy may cause muscle problems in newborn babies. There are no adequate, well-controlled studies in pregnant women. Please inform your doctor before taking Tolaz LA 405mg/vial Convenience Kit if you are pregnant or planning pregnancy. Your doctor will weigh the potential risks and benefits before prescribing Tolaz LA 405mg/vial Convenience Kit.
Breast Feeding
Unsafe
Tolaz LA 405mg/vial Convenience Kit is excreted into the breast milk. Hence it is not recommended for a nursing mother. Please inform your doctor before using Tolaz LA 405mg/vial Convenience Kit if you are a breastfeeding mother.
Driving
Unsafe
Tolaz LA 405mg/vial Convenience Kit may make you feel dizzy or drowsy. Do not drive or operate machinery if you are not mentally alert or experience any symptoms that affect your ability to concentrate.
Liver
Caution
Tolaz LA 405mg/vial Convenience Kit should not be used in case of Hepatitis (including hepatocellular, cholestatic or mixed liver injury). If you have a history of liver disease, inform your doctor before receiving Tolaz LA 405mg/vial Convenience Kit. Your doctor may adjust the dose of this medicine or prescribe a suitable alternative based on your condition.
Kidney
Caution
If you have a history of kidney disease, inform your doctor before receiving Tolaz LA 405mg/vial Convenience Kit. Your doctor may adjust the dose of this medicine or prescribe a suitable alternative based on your condition.
Children
Unsafe
Tolaz LA 405mg/vial Convenience Kit is not indicated for use in treating children and adolescents below 18 years of age. Please seek medical advice.
Heart
Caution
Inform your doctor before receiving the Tolaz LA 405mg/vial Convenience Kit if you have heart disease. Your doctor will prescribe only if the benefits outweigh the risks.
Geriatrics
Caution
Tolaz LA 405mg/vial Convenience Kit should be used with caution in elderly patients. Please consult your doctor before use.
Tolaz LA 405mg/vial Convenience Kit is used to treat Schizophrenia and bipolar I disorder.
Tolaz LA 405mg/vial Convenience Kit contains Olanzapine, an antipsychotic that balances the chemical messengers in the brain, improving mood, behaviour and thoughts.
Tolaz LA 405mg/vial Convenience Kit should be used with caution in the medical history of allergic reactions, liver or kidney diseases, heart problems, Alzheimer's disease, high cholesterol, glaucoma, diabetes, stomach/intestinal problems, breathing problems during sleep (sleep apnea), low white blood cell count, breast cancer, enlarged prostate, or fits. Please let your doctor know if you have any other medical history before starting the treatment with Tolaz LA 405mg/vial Convenience Kit.
Tolaz LA 405mg/vial Convenience Kit may make you sweat less and can likely cause a heart stroke. Hence, limiting activities that cause overheating, like an exercise in hot weather or using hot tubs, is advised. Drink plenty of fluids and dress lightly.
Tolaz LA 405mg/vial Convenience Kit may cause dizziness. It is advised to avoid getting up too fast from a sitting or lying position that can make you feel dizzy.
